#845931 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#845931 is composed of 51.8% red, 34.9%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32.6% magenta, 62.9%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 28.9 degrees, a saturation of 45.9% and a lightness of 35.5%. #845931 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b262 with #090000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#845931 color description : Dark moderate orange.
#845931 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#845931 has RGB values of R:132, G:89,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.33, Y:0.63,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 8673585.

Shades and Tints of #845931
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030201 is the darkest color, while #fbf7f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#845931
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#615a54 is the less saturated color, while #b55700 is the most saturated one.
